For my card, I used a Cuttlebug die cut and embossing folder combo for the butterfly. I mixed a couple Creative Inspirations Paints to make this navy color, I used Royal Blue and Onyx. I added some Recollections rhinestones to it. The ribbon is from May Arts. The patterned paper is from Pink Paislee's Bayberry Cottage. I punched it with a Martha Stewart border punch.
